Who Should Join Grassroots Grantmakers? Funders who are working to strengthen resident-led organizations and their leaders in urban neighborhoods or rural communities, and are interested in supporting social change at the grassroots. Our growing network welcomes community foundations, private foundations, family foundations, corporate funders, local governments, and other private and public grantmakers.
We also invite non-grantmaking entities who work directly with resident-led grassroots organizations - technical assistance providers, for example - to join us as "Friends". What Does It Cost? Contributing memberships in Grassroots Grantmakers are renewable on an annual basis. Membership contributions range from $500 to $20,000, with $500 as the entry threshold for membership. Organizations that contribute $5,000 or more are invited to recognize others working in concert in their own community as a Grassroots Grantmakers Cluster . Individuals who are not associated with a grantmaking entity but who support the values of grassroots grantmaking are invited to join the network as a Friend with a contribution of $100.
